What is Epoxy Flooring?

 

 

Epoxy flooring is a type of seamless flooring system that's made by mixing epoxy resin with a hardening agent. This chemical reaction creates a durable, high-gloss surface that's resistant to stains, chemical compounds, abrasion, and moisture. Epoxy flooring is commonly utilized in residential, commercial, and industrial settings as a consequence of its exceptional durability, low maintenance requirements, and customizable design options.

Types of Epoxy Flooring Systems:

 

 

There are a number of types of epoxy flooring systems available, each with its own unique properties and applications. Some frequent types of epoxy flooring systems include:

 

 

 

 

Strong Epoxy Flooring: Solid epoxy flooring consists of multiple layers of epoxy resin that are utilized directly to the substrate. It provides a seamless and durable surface that's immune to stains, chemical substances, and abrasion.

 

 

 

 

Metallic Epoxy Flooring: Metallic epoxy flooring incorporates metallic pigments or additives into the epoxy resin to create a surprising, three-dimensional effect. It offers a unique and splendid end that resembles polished marble or natural stone.

 

 

 

 

Quartz Epoxy Flooring: Quartz epoxy flooring combines epoxy resin with quartz aggregates to create a textured surface that is slip-resistant and highly durable. It is commonly utilized in commercial and industrial settings the place safety and durability are paramount.

 

 

 

 

Flake Epoxy Flooring: Flake epoxy flooring incorporates decorative vinyl flakes or chips into the epoxy resin to create a speckled or terrazzo-like appearance. It offers excellent slip resistance and is commonly utilized in garage floors, commercial kitchens, and locker rooms.

Installation Process:

 

 

The installation process for epoxy flooring typically entails the following steps:

 

 

 

 

Surface Preparation: The existing substrate have to be properly cleaned, repaired, and primed before applying the epoxy coating. This might contain removing present coatings, repairing cracks or damage, and diamond grinding or shot blasting the surface to create a clean and porous substrate.

 

 

 

 

Primer Application: A primer coat is utilized to the prepared substrate to promote adhesion and bonding between the epoxy coating and the substrate. The primer is allowed to cure earlier than proceeding to the subsequent step.

 

 

 

 

Epoxy Coating Application: The epoxy coating is applied to the primed substrate utilizing a roller or squeegee. A number of coats may be utilized to achieve the desired thickness and coverage. Ornamental additives reminiscent of metallic pigments, quartz aggregates, or vinyl flakes can be incorporated into the epoxy coating for added aesthetic appeal.

 

 

 

 

Topcoat Sealing: Once the epoxy coating has cured, a clear topcoat sealer is applied to protect the surface and enhance its durability and longevity. The topcoat sealer is allowed to cure fully before the epoxy flooring is ready for use.

 

 

 

 

Maintenance Suggestions:

 

 

To maximise the lifespan and performance of epoxy flooring, observe these upkeep tips:

 

 

 

 

Common Cleaning: Sweep or vacuum the floor often to remove dirt, dust, and debris. Mop the floor with a light detergent and water resolution to remove stains and spills. Avoid utilizing har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ners that can damage the epoxy coating.

 

 

 

 

Protect High-Traffic Areas: Place rugs or mats in high-site visitors areas to protect the epoxy flooring from scratches, scuffs, and abrasion. Use furniture pads or coasters under heavy furniture legs to prevent them from scratching or denting the surface.

 

 

 

 

Prompt Spill Cleanup: Clean up spills promptly to forestall staining and damage to the epoxy coating. Use a clean cloth or paper towel to blot up spills as soon as they happen, and clean the affected area with a gentle detergent and water solution.

 

 

 

 

Avoid Extreme Moisture: While epoxy flooring is proof against moisture, excessive publicity to water or moisture can damage the epoxy coating over time. Avoid leaving standing water on the floor for prolonged periods and promptly clean up any spills or leaks.

 

 

 

 

Schedule Periodic Maintenance: Schedule periodic upkeep inspections to check for signs of wear, damage, or deterioration. Repair any cracks, chips, or damage promptly to stop further deterioration and prolong the lifespan of the epoxy flooring.
